Ingredients
- For the tortellini:
- 1 (12-ounce) package fresh or frozen cheese tortellini
- 2 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il, divided
- 1 shallot, chopped
- kosher salt, to taste
- 2 cloves garlic, sliced
- 3/4 cup fresh or frozen petite peas
- 3/4 cup sugar snap peas, sliced
- 3 tablespoons unsalted butter
- 1/4 cup fresh basil, chopped
- 2 tablespoons mint, chopped
- 2 tablespoons fresh tarragon, chopped
- 2 tablespoons lemon juice
- Optional, for serving:
- 1 teaspoon lemon zest, finely grated
- 2 ounces prosciutto, torn into bite-size pieces
- 1 (4-ounce) ball burrata
- crushed red pepper flakes, to taste
Directions
Step 1 -In a large pot of salted, boiling water, add the tortellini and 1 tablespoon of the oil and cook, stirring occasionally, until they are almost al dente, about 1 minute less than package instructions. Drain the water.
Step 2 -While the tortellini are cooking, in a large skillet over medium heat, add the remaining oil.
Step 3 -Add the shallots to the oil and season with the salt. Cook, while stirring, until they start to soften, about 2-3 minutes.
Step 4 -Add the garlic to the shallots and cook, while stirring, until it is fragrant, about 1 minute.
Step 5 -Add the petite peas and the sugar snap peas to the shallot-garlic mixture and cook, stirring occasionally, until the peas are just heated through, about 2-3 minutes.
Step 6 -Pour the pea mixture in a medium bowl.
Step 7 -In the same skillet over medium heat, melt the butter.
Step 8 -Add the tortellini to the melted butter and toss to coat.
Step 9 -Spread the tortellini in an even later and cook, tossing occasionally, until they are golden-brown and al dente, about 5-6 minutes.
Step 10 -Reduce the heat to low. Add the pea mixture to the tortellini and toss to combine.
Step 11 -Stir the basil, the mint, the tarragon, the lemon juice, and the salt into the tortellini mixture and stir to combine.
Step 12 -Serve the tortellini with your desired toppings.
